Calls for more community policing

Police forces need to forge closer working relationships with local communities to help bring down crime levels, a new report claims.

The Chief Inspector of Constabulary highlights evidence which shows crime levels fall when local people are given more of a say in policing priorities.
The report praised community police officers, but said they were frequently taken away to do other jobs.
